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’s) For Cardiology Clinical Consultant
What are the key responsibilities of a Cardiology Clinical Consultant?
The key responsibilities of a Cardiology Clinical Consultant include providing clinical expertise and guidance to cardiology physicians, collaborating with healthcare providers to develop and implement clinical pathways and protocols, conducting thorough patient evaluations and case reviews, staying abreast of the latest clinical research and advancements in cardiology, supporting clinical trials and research studies, leading educational sessions and providing mentorship to healthcare professionals, and partnering with nurses, pharmacists, and other healthcare professionals to ensure a comprehensive approach to patient care.
What are the qualifications for a Cardiology Clinical Consultant?
The qualifications for a Cardiology Clinical Consultant typically include a Doctor of Medicine (M.D.) degree, board certification in cardiovascular disease, and several years of experience in cardiology. Additional qualifications may include expertise in specific areas of cardiology, such as echocardiography or electrophysiology, and a commitment to continuing education and professional development.
What are the career prospects for a Cardiology Clinical Consultant?
The career prospects for a Cardiology Clinical Consultant are excellent. As the demand for specialized cardiovascular care continues to grow, the need for qualified Cardiology Clinical Consultants will also increase. With experience and additional training, Cardiology Clinical Consultants can advance to leadership positions in hospitals, clinics, and research institutions.
What are the challenges faced by Cardiology Clinical Consultants?
The challenges faced by Cardiology Clinical Consultants include the need to keep up with the latest clinical research and advancements in cardiology, the complex and often time-consuming nature of patient care, and the need to balance clinical responsibilities with administrative and research duties.
What are the rewards of being a Cardiology Clinical Consultant?
The rewards of being a Cardiology Clinical Consultant include the opportunity to make a real difference in the lives of patients, the intellectual challenge of working with complex medical cases, and the satisfaction of contributing to the advancement of medical knowledge.
What is the average salary for a Cardiology Clinical Consultant?
The average salary for a Cardiology Clinical Consultant in the United States is around $200,000 per year. However, salaries can vary depending on experience, location, and employer.
